比特币钱包设计:安全性与用户体验的完美结合

引言

在数字货币的世界里,比特币钱包无疑是每一个投资者、交易者和普通用户必不可少的工具。随着比特币及其他数字资产受到越来越多的关注,钱包的设计和安全性成为用户选购钱包时最为关心的因素之一。本文将深入探索比特币钱包设计的关键要素,包括安全性、用户体验、功能设计与未来发展趋势等。同时,我们将围绕设计比特币钱包时常见的问题进行详细阐述,以帮助用户更好地理解与选择适合自己的加密货币钱包。

一、比特币钱包的基本概念

比特币钱包是用来存储、接收和发送比特币及其他数字货币的工具。不同于传统银行账户,比特币钱包的运作基于区块链技术,其中每一笔交易都是公开且可以追溯的。比特币钱包的主要类型分为热钱包和冷钱包:

  • 热钱包:连接互联网,可以方便地进行交易,但相对来说安全性较低,容易受到网络攻击。
  • 冷钱包:不连接互联网,安全性更强,适合长期存储数字资产,但不便于快速交易。

无论是哪种类型的比特币钱包,都必须具备安全性、易用性和高效性,这为钱包设计提出了极高的要求。

二、安全性:钱包设计的首要考虑

安全性是设计比特币钱包时最重要的考量因素。在数字货币的交易中,安全漏洞往往会导致严重的资产损失,以下是设计比特币钱包时必须重视的安全措施:

1. 多重签名技术

多重签名(Multisig)技术要求多个密钥才能进行一笔交易。例如,一个比特币钱包可以设置为需要2个密钥的3个持有者中的任意2个签名才能完成交易。这种设计显著提升了安全性,减少了单点故障的风险。

2. 私钥的安全存储

私钥是访问和控制比特币钱包的唯一凭证,其安全性直接关系到资产的安全。设计钱包时,应当采用加密来保护私钥,并且用户最好将私钥存储在安全的地方,比如硬件钱包或纸质钱包。

3. 反钓鱼与反网络攻击

为了抵御网络攻击,钱包应具备反钓鱼机制,比如在用户输入敏感信息时使用安全提示,或在检测到异常登录时进行警告。此外,要定期更新软件,以修复潜在的安全漏洞。

4. 备份与恢复机制

钱包设计中需要考虑到用户的资产恢复能力,提供易于使用的备份与恢复机制,比如生成助记词(mnemonic phrase),用户可以根据这些助记词在新钱包上恢复资产。

三、用户体验:优雅的设计与互动

在设计比特币钱包时,用户体验同样至关重要。在功能复杂和操作繁琐的数字资产管理中,设计者要努力为用户提供简洁直观的界面,以提高可用性。

1. 界面友好的设计

用户界面(UI)设计应简洁、直观,减少用户的学习成本。设计时可以参考流行的应用程序如手机银行,让用户在使用比特币钱包时感到熟悉与舒适。

2. 流畅的操作流程

用户需要在钱包内完成多种操作,包括接收比特币、发送比特币、查看交易历史等。设计流程时,应尽量简化操作步骤,通过引导提示帮助用户快速完成任务。

3. 及时的反馈与支持

设计的比特币钱包要在用户操作时提供及时的反馈,比如交易提交后显示发送成功的提示,并向用户展示预计到账时间。同时,应提供在线支持或帮助文档,以帮助用户解决可能遇到的问题。

4. 适应多种设备

由于比特币用户可能在不同的设备上使用钱包,钱包设计应考虑响应式设计,使得钱包能够在手机、平板和桌面等多种设备上流畅运行。

四、功能设计:必要的功能与附加功能

比特币钱包的功能设计不仅要满足基本的转账、收款等需求,还有潜在的附加功能可以提升用户体验。

1. 交易历史管理

用户需要方便地查看过去的交易记录,因此钱包应当提供详细的交易历史,包括交易时间、金额、状态等,帮助用户跟踪资产流动。

2. 实时市场数据

为了帮助用户做出交易决策,钱包可以整合市场行情数据,实时展示比特币及其他数字货币的价格变化,支持用户随时关注市场动态。

3. 钱包内置交换功能

一些钱包还提供内置交换功能,用户可以在钱包内直接进行不同数字资产的兑换。这种功能可极大提升用户的便利性,减少在多个平台间切换的抗挫能力。

4. 社区交互与社交功能

除了金融功能,钱包设计也可以集成社交功能,比如让用户能够结识其他数字货币投资者,并分享投资经验和策略,形成活跃的社区氛围。

5. 定制化设置

用户的需求多样,钱包设计应允许用户定制其使用体验,比如按需启用或禁用某些功能,调节通知偏好等。

五、比特币钱包的未来发展趋势

随着区块链技术的不断发展,比特币钱包的设计与功能也在逐步演变。

1. 去中心化钱包的崛起

去中心化钱包没有单一的控制方,用户完全掌握自己的私钥。这种趋势将推动用户对安全性与隐私保护的重视,去中心化钱包的设计将愈加受到关注。

2. 增强现实与虚拟现实技术的应用

随着AR和VR技术的发展,未来比特币钱包可能借助这些新兴技术提升用户体验,让用户在三维空间中进行交易和资产管理,提供更直观舒适的交互方式。

3. AI与机器学习的融入

人工智能和机器学习的应用将帮助钱包提供个性化的建议与安全监控,根据用户的交易习惯进行分析并提供智能投顾,提升用户的投资效率和安全性。

4. 更多的支持币种与功能扩展

随着数字货币的不断增加,未来的比特币钱包将可能支持更多的币种,并提供更多的功能,如兼容DeFi(去中心化金融)、NFT(非同质化代币)等新兴资产。

问答环节

比特币钱包的安全策略有哪些?

比特币钱包的安全策略至关重要。首先,用户应该采用多重签名技术来加强钱包安全,这样即使黑客获取了某个签名也不能完成交易。其次,用户要时刻保持私钥的安全,切勿将其保存在网络环境中或分享给他人。此外,使用冷钱包存储长期资产即可有效防止网络攻击,而热钱包则适用于日常小额交易。最后,定期对钱包软件进行更新,以修复安全漏洞。

如何选择适合自己的比特币钱包?

选择比特币钱包时首先要考虑的是用途。如果需要频繁交易,则热钱包可能更适合。而如果只用来长期存储,那么冷钱包将是更好的选择。其次,用户应评估钱包的安全性、易用性和功能丰富性,关注是否支持多种币种以及交易费用等。此外,还应该查看用户评价和社区反馈,以做出最明智的决定。

比特币钱包的备份与恢复应该怎么做?

备份和恢复是用户在使用比特币钱包时必须掌握的技能。用户在创建钱包时通常会被要求生成一个助记词或种子短语,这是恢复钱包的关键。建议用户在安全的地方面写下来并妥善保存。如果用户需要恢复钱包,只需用助记词在新钱包上进行导入即可。因此,确保助记词的安全是至关重要的。

如何保护比特币钱包不被恶意软件侵害?

保护比特币钱包的一个有效措施是安装靠谱的安全软件,定期进行病毒扫描。同时,注重操作系统和钱包软件的更新,及时呈现安全漏洞。另外,用户在下载钱包时要确保选择官方渠道,避免第三方下载产生的安全隐患。在使用公共Wi-Fi时,应避免直接进行数字货币交易,以降低黑客入侵的风险。

比特币钱包与普通银行账户有什么区别?

比特币钱包与传统银行账户区别主要体现在去中心化和对用户资产的控制权上。比特币钱包没有中心化的金融机构来管理,用户完全自己掌控私钥,相对更加安全。其次,比特币的交易是匿名和快速的,且无国界限制,而传统银行转账往往需要几天,且涉及复杂的手续费与验证程序。此外,传统银行也可能因为政策原因限制取款,而比特币钱包则不受此类限制,极大提升了灵活性。

总结

比特币钱包的设计不仅是技术与用户体验的结合,更关乎用户的资产安全与管理方式。通过深入探讨比特币钱包的各种设计元素、关键功能和未来的发展趋势,我们希望能帮助读者全面了解比特币钱包的使用和选择。随着数字货币市场的不断成熟,相信比特币钱包的设计也会随着用户需求的变化而不断进化,提供更安全、更便捷的服务。